Question:
How does the weld preparation command works?
Answer:
1. First you need to create a cutting part to the location where you want the weld preparation. For example a profile PL20*20, rotated 45 degrees.
2. On the Steel tab, click Weld > Prepare part for welding with another part
3. Select the part to be weld-prepared (gray beam).
4. Select the cutting part (green part).
5. The results you can see below. The command is much similar to part cut, but additionally this command automatically deletes the cutting part.
